Bracket Function : The function I : R → Z defined by I(x) = n where n ≤ x < n+1 is called the bracket function or the step function or the integral part function . Notation : Integral part of x in R is denoted by I(x) or [x]. Definition : If x 𝞊 R , x - [x] is called the Fractional part of x. Note : [x] ≤ x < [x] + 1 or x-1 < [x] ≤ x. For every x 𝞊 R, x ≥ [x] , hence the fractional part of x is always non-negative x 𝞊 Z ⇔ x=[x].
